lyh 3 ani în urmă
părinte
comite
14180a323a

+ 1 - 1
apps/account/views.py

@@ -49,7 +49,7 @@ def login(request):
         return JSONResponse({
             'user_id': user.id,
             'access_token': form.access_token,
-            'name': user.name,
+            'name': user.name or user.username,
             'superuser': superuser,
         })
     else:

+ 4 - 0
apps/activity/serializers.py

@@ -12,6 +12,8 @@ from apps.foundation.models import BizLog
 from apps.customer.models import Customer
 from apps.account.models import Branch
 from apps import base
+from libs.booleancharfield import PriceShowCharField
+
 
 class BranchSerializer(serializers.ModelSerializer):
     enabled_text = serializers.SerializerMethodField()
@@ -95,6 +97,8 @@ class OrderSerializer(serializers.ModelSerializer):
     delete_text = serializers.SerializerMethodField()
     split_status_text = serializers.SerializerMethodField()
     create_time = serializers.DateTimeField(format='%Y-%m-%d %H:%M', read_only=True)
+    amount = PriceShowCharField(read_only=True)
+    rebate = PriceShowCharField(read_only=True)
 
     class Meta:
         model = Order

+ 1 - 1
libs/booleancharfield.py

@@ -2,7 +2,7 @@
 
 from rest_framework import serializers
 from libs.utils import strftime,strfdate
-from apps.base import Formater
+from util.format import Formater
 
 def getAttributeValue(instance, obj):
     if '.' in instance.source:

+ 5 - 0
uis/views/activity/index.html

@@ -121,6 +121,11 @@
     var superuser = layui.data(layui.setter.tableName)['superuser'];
       if(!superuser){
           $('#show_check').remove();
+      }else {
+          $('#btn_add').remove();
+          $('#btn_set').remove();
+          $('#btn_coupon').remove();
+          $('#btn_del').remove();
       }
 
     table.render({